Beyond Facebook's policies, artificial engagement practices are drawing increased scrutiny from regulators worldwide. The Federal Trade Commission (FTC) has taken action against companies that engage in deceptive engagement farming practices. The NGL case, for instance, established that misleading engagement practices are "likely illegal when used deceptively to prod consumers along a subscription funnel".
